Blends of SBS triblock copolymer with poly(2,6-dimethyl-1,4-phenylene oxide)/polystyrene mixture

abstract:
Blends of styrenebutadienestyrene (SBS)
or styrene ethylene/1-butenestyrene (SEBS) triblock copolymers
with a commercial mixture of polystyrene (PS)
and poly(2,6-dimethyl-1,4-phenylene oxide) (PPO) were
prepared in the melt at different temperatures according to
the chemical kind of the copolymer. Although solution-cast
SBS/PPO and SBS/PS blends were already known in the
literature, a general and systematic study of the miscibility
of the PS/PPO blend with a styrene-based triblock copolymer
in the melt was still missing. The thermal and mechanical
behavior of SBS/(PPO/PS) blends was investigated by
means of DSC and dynamic thermomechanical analysis
(DMTA). The results were then compared to analogous
SEBS/(PPO/PS) blends, for which the presence of a saturated
ole.nic block allowed processing at higher temperatures
(220°C instead of 180°C). All the blends were further
characterized by SEM and TGA to tentatively relate the
observed properties with the blends morphology and degradation
temperature.
